| Shanxi province is one of the major provinces as important corn production in Chain, and Yuci district is the main area of corn production in Shanxi province.In recent years, the full mechanization of corn production in Shanxi province has been lagging behind, technology difficulties of corn mechanized harvesting have severely restricted the development of agricultural modernization and corn full mechanization. Only improved the level of corn mechanized harvesting, mechanization would be achieved, thereby agricultural development in Shanxi province would be promoted.Demonstration area construction about corn full mechanization of Agriculture Ministry has been undertaken by Yuci district, Shanxi province. In order to get better demonstration area construction, the thesis attempts to comb the existing literature related to the corn full mechanization research, summarizes current situation of agriculture and corn mechanization in Yuci district, emphasizes the study on the comparative tests of corn combine, analyses reasonably impact factors of corn full mechanization in Yuci district. Through combining with practical experience of corn planting in demonstration area construction, present this thesis, which make the study on the full mechanization of corn become meaningful with high practical value.The thesis combines with practical experience of demonstration area construction about corn full mechanization of Agriculture Ministry, in the process of corn planting, traditional pattern of corn planting has been made effort to improve technologically. Every process has been operated by advanced and appropriate mechanical technology, in terms of process flow, technical essentials, production criterion, equipment assembling, service pattern, summarizes the main production pattern of full mechanization which is propitious to popularize in Yuci district as well as the equipment assembling plan and criterion of every production process. The results of this thesis are based on a series of mechanized production patterns, which includes fertilization and souring, field management, mechanically harvesting, straws returning and rotary tillage. Its aim is to ease workers for other jobs, save labor cost, raise incomes and promote the development of agricultural modernization. |
